Continuing with the commission I did for one of my friends. He got the tabletop game “Namiji” via Kickstarter (https://www.kickstarter.com/projects/funforge/namiji-the-next-chapter-in-the-tokaido-universe?lang=de). Well the paintjob of the minis was not to his liking and so he gave those 10 little ships to me. This is the one called “Noh” (what ever that means^^). The difference should be obvious. First the artwork, then the grim reality and finally my painted version. :-)
Also pretty happy at how the water turned out.

Next Meeting, 12th December 2023
Our next meeting will be Tuesday 12th December 2023. As usual, we will start playing shorter games from 7.30pm as people arrive, until 8pm when we will start something a little longer. The pub is doing food, and the table is booked from 6.30pm for those that would like to eat first. This week, the “Feature Game” will be Namiji (rules, review and How to Play video), which is a Time-track game,…
